Picking the Right Circular Downpipe Type

Deciding the optimal round downpipe material for your residence is vital for long-term functionality and aesthetic look. Popular options offer PVC, metal, bronze, and rust-resistant steel. PVC is a low-cost choice that’s easy to position, but could not resist severe conditions. Aluminum is lightweight and impervious to rust, but may dent readily. Copper provides a traditional style and excellent longevity, but is a greater costly option. Finally, stainless steel is extremely long-lasting and rust-proof, making it a good long-term option.

Deciding the Circular vs. Square Gutter Downspout : What Is Superior

When planning new gutter framework, the pick between a round and a square downpipe can be a often complex decision . Cylindrical downpipes tend to be generally affordable and provide a traditional look , whereas square downpipes lend a more contemporary feel and might more match certain architectural designs . Finally , the preferred option is based on a budget and personal tastes .
